Dọc theo chiều dài, ta trồng được:
\(5.5 : \frac{1}{4} = 22\) (khóm hoa)
Dọc theo chiều rộng, ta trồng được:
\(3 , 75 : \frac{1}{4} = 15\) (khóm hoa)
Như vậy, số khóm hoa trồng được dọc theo hai cạnh của mảnh vườn là:
\(\left[\right. \left(\right. 22 + 15 \left.\right) . 2 \left]\right. - 4 = 70\) (khóm hoa)
(Chú thích, ta phải trừ đi 4 khóm hoa do 4 khóm hoa ở 4 góc hình chữ nhật được đếm 2 lần)
Đáp số: 70 khóm hoa
